Abstract :
The dependence on the topological θ angle term in quantum field theory is usually discussed in the context of instanton calculus. There the observables are 2π periodic, analytic functions of θ. However, in strongly coupled theories, the semi-classical instanton approximation can break down due to infrared divergences. Instances are indeed known where analyticity in θ can be lost, while the 2π periodicity is preserved. In this short Letter we exhibit a simple two-dimensional example where the 2π periodicity is lost. The observables remain periodic under the transformation θ↦θ+2kπ for some k⩾2. We also briefly discuss the case of four-dimensional N=2 supersymmetric gauge theories.
